Joyriding
Joyriding (Misdemeanor)
- Statutory Authority. | Okla. Stat. tit. 21, § 1787.
- Jury Instructions. | Oklahoma Uniform Jury Instruction CR 5-120.

Oklahoma Criminal Law
From and after the passage of this act, it shall be unlawful for any person or persons to loiter in or upon any automobile or motor vehicle, or to deface or injure such automobile or motor vehicle, or to "molest, drive, or attempt to drive any automobile, for joyriding or any other purpose, or" to manipulate or meddle with any machinery or appliances thereof without the consent of the owner of such automobile or motor vehicle.
